Job Duties
- Greets and check in patients arriving for an appointment, helps patients feel welcome
- verifies necessary information for patient appointments including current patient data in ECW and type of clinical visit
- verifies patient insurance coverage and ensures demographic information accuracy prior to appointments
- assists with next day appointment reminders and notes actions in ECW
- prepares paperwork for patients to complete before appointments
- documents patient cancellations and no-shows following protocol
- receives deliveries and distributes to appropriate personnel
- maintains cleanliness and orderliness of reception and waiting areas
- maintains patient confidentiality at all times
